8 Individuals Arrested on Caramoan, Camarines Sur Over Vote Buying
Eight individuals were arrested in Caramoan, Camarines Sur for allegedly being involved in vote buying during the election period.

Recently, Caramoan MPS shared photos of individuals who were arrested in Zone 5, Barangay Sta. Cruz over a serious violation of election laws. The post garnered various reactions from the online community.
According to initial reports, the arrest was made in line with COMELEC Resolution No. 11104, which supports Section 261(a) of the Omnibus Election Code. This law strictly prohibits vote buying, a practice that undermines fair and honest elections.

During the operation, authorities were able to confiscate a total of P100,650 in cash. The money was believed to be intended for distribution to influence voters in the area.
Investigations are still ongoing to determine the extent of the illegal activity. Authorities are looking into who may have organized or financed the vote buying operation, and if more people were involved beyond those already arrested.
